Discussion

Novell Netware SMB Remote Buffer Overflow Vulnerability

Netware is prone to a remote buffer-overflow vulnerability.

Attackers can exploit this issue to execute arbitrary code with kernel privileges. Failed attacks may cause a denial-of-service condition.

Netware versions 6.5 SP8 and prior are affected.
